- Physical Description
- 2 m of textual records. -- 143 photographs : transparencies, prints. -- 7 motion pictures : films, video recordings
- Scope & Content
- Consists of five series. I. Minutes, 1964-1991, ca.20 cm of textual records; II. Administrative files, 1974-1991, ca.156 cm of textual records; III. Other records, 1958-1985, 10.5 cm and 14 v.; IV. Publications, 1977-1991, 2 cm of printed material; V. Photographs and films, ca.1970-1988, 143 photographs and 7 motion pictures. Records pertain mainly to Chamber of Commerce operations and Banff events.

- History / Biographical
- Imperial Order Daughters of the Empire (I.O.D.E.), Mount Rundle Chapter, was formed in 1913 at Banff, Alberta- and included a number of prominent women in the community. Much of their work was patriotic in nature, particularly during the First World War, when a relief fund was organized. This chapter continued community service activities during the inter-war period. The Mount Temple Chapter, formed 1939, included younger women. Both chapters performed war work during the Second World War. The Mount Rundle Chapter disbanded in 1951, while the Mount Temple Chapter continues to provide community service.
- Scope & Content
- Fonds consists of Mount Rundle Chapter minute books, 1913-1951 including loose notes; and Mount Temple Chapter minute books, 1939-1978; and Mount Temple Chapter records, including minutes and correspondence, 1989-1992. Minutes for 1960-1964 are missing.
